I will get a picture of the complete bike, but this was the frame. I believe it had an MRP Ribbon fork.

This is an original Kickstarter backer's bike, stolen from the back of a car outside a restaurant in Duluth MN on Sat, July 28.

There are less than 60 of these in the known universe, maybe 25 in the U.S. This thing should stick out like a sore thumb.

Not a bad mention from the year long test of the Shinning, 170 fr/165 rr 29er.

Best of Test '18

The article itself is fairly light, as they did a more comprehensive review of the bike early this year.

The challenge was that they were to use this bike as a test bed for everything else they were testing, droppers, forks, etc. So it was horsewhipped, flogged and parts swapped over and over in the course of the year.

"Tantrum Cycles and the Missing Link are a huge success, standing their ground and proving its worth against the big ones in a full season of hard charging and being used as official testing platform by TNI-de" "the result is something very innovative and a great bike....from a one man show truly challenging the big player's bikes"
